Proposal writers must weave Award compliance directly into the technical methodology and pricing narrative, demonstrating that competitive rates do not compromise legal wage obligations. This involves crafting specific sections detailing workforce management, transparent payroll auditing, and adherence to Fair Work Ombudsman standards to reassure NSW eTendering evaluators.

## Executive Summary Patterning for NSW Health Cleaning Tenders

Crafting an executive summary for a $4.2M clinical cleaning contract published on NSW eTendering requires mapping narrative arcs directly to the NSW Health Infection Prevention and Control Policy Directive PD2017_013. Proposal writers must anchor the opening paragraph to the specific Local Health District (LHD) strategic plan, such as the Sydney Local Health District Strategic Plan 2018-2023, demonstrating immediate alignment with regional clinical governance frameworks. When addressing the mandatory Environmental Cleaning Standard Operating Procedures, the summary must explicitly quantify past performance, such as maintaining a 99.8% ATP bioluminescence pass rate across 450 hospital beds at the Royal Prince Alfred Hospital. ## Structuring the Technical Methodology for Transport for NSW Facilities

Detailing the technical methodology for a Sydney Trains station cleaning contract demands strict adherence to the AS/NZS 3733:2018 standard for textile floor coverings and the ISO 9001:2015 quality management framework. Proposal writers must break down deliverables into shift-specific milestones, such as completing the deep-cleaning of the Central Station Grand Concourse between the 01:00 and 03:30 trackwork windows. Dependencies within this methodology must explicitly reference the Transport for NSW (TfNSW) Contractor Health and Safety Management System (CHSMS) requirements, particularly regarding high-voltage rail corridor access permits. ## Injecting Social Value under the NSW Government SME and Regional Procurement Policy

Aligning the social value response with the NSW Government SME and Regional Procurement Policy requires proposal writers to commit a quantifiable percentage of the $3.5M Department of Education school cleaning contract to local enterprises. The narrative must explicitly detail engagement with Supply Nation certified Indigenous businesses to meet the 1.5% contract value target mandated by the NSW Aboriginal Procurement Policy (APP). When detailing the employment of disadvantaged youth in Western Sydney, the response must reference the specific training pathways aligned to the Certificate III in Cleaning Operations (CPP30316) delivered through TAFE NSW. ## Drafting Compliance Responses with Fair Work Act Evidence Citations

Drafting the mandatory industrial relations compliance schedules for a Department of Defence base cleaning contract published on AusTender requires explicit citation of the Cleaning Services Award 2020 (MA000022). Proposal writers must provide concrete evidence of compliance with the Fair Work Act 2009, specifically detailing the application of the 15% afternoon shift loading for the 14:00 to 22:00 barracks cleaning roster. For this $5.6M Holsworthy Barracks facility services agreement, the response must include redacted payslip examples demonstrating adherence to the specific superannuation guarantee rate of 11.5% mandated by the Australian Taxation Office.
